A fine antique lacquered brass compound microscope by the London maker, William Watson & Sons, this being the company's popular'Edinburgh' Student model mounted on the H stand. Fitted with coarse and fine focusing, twin objective turret, mechanical stage and substage condenser, the microscope comes complete within original fitted mahogany case and owners handbook.

The stand is engraved "W Watson and Sons Ltd, 313 High Holborn, London" and a separate cross member is engraved "H Edin Studt". The microscope dates to around 1920 and has a working height of around 43cm. Watson and Sons were opticians and camera makers, founded by William Watson in 1837. In later years, the company was run by William's sons, Charles and Henry. Watson and Sons incorporated in 1908, becoming Watson and Sons Ltd. The company earned a strong reputation for the fine quality of its instruments, eventually comprising not only microscopes but also fine cameras, lenses, magic lanterns and surveyors instruments.
